Jefferson Reed 1818–1885 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 5 July 1818

Birth Location: Limestone, Alabama, USA

Death Date: 9 March 1885

Death Location: Rogers, Bell, Texas, United States

Father: Michael Reed

Mother: Martha Burnett

Spouse(s): Patsy Cobb

Children(s): Patsy Goggans

In 1818, Jefferson Reed entered the world in Limestone, Alabama, USA, born to Michael Reed And Martha Fermin Burnett. Jefferson Reed married Patsy Cobb, and had children including Patsy Goggans. Jefferson Reed passed away in 1885 in Rogers, Bell, Texas, United States.
